The government base is a covert facility in a remote desert location.

History

When Stan Pines activates the universe portal for the first time in "Scary-oke," the facility intercepted the signal and sent Agents Powers and Trigger to Gravity Falls, Oregon, to investigate the phenomenon.

Appearance

The base is a concrete structure comprised of an operational building, adjoined by a garage. The only known entrance is a heavy, sealed door, illuminated by a fluorescent light above it. There is a high set strip of windows on the front side, and the roof is outfitted with solar panels and large satellite dishes. Due to the base's secretive nature, it is isolated in the middle of a desert. Little of the inside is seen, though it is shown to have state-of-the art surveillance equipment.
